Breaking Myth: Women Career As Truck Driver


From starting the trucking industry is being a male-dominated industry. Presently also there are more men than women in this industry. But there is another side of the story as well; women are emerging as a major resource to the trucking industry. They are pushing their Image to extend which is positive for the industry. Women take good care of the equipment, are easier to train, and have superior customer service and paperwork expertise. For women without a college degree, driving a truck gives greater advantages and greater stability than usual positions such as food facility or home healthcare assistance.

Despite the curve, image is an issue when it comes to women in the industries. 90% of drivers are male; trucking has long been out looked as a manly profession. CALIFORNIA CDL RENEWAL REQUIREMENTS AND RELATED FAQS

  California CDL Renewal:   There are some requirements to get your commercial Driver's license renewed. The key requirements are listed below: Renewal of CDL License in Person Visit your local Department of Motor Vehicle office (DMV). It is always better to book a prior online appointment to  renew CDL online in California Fill and sign up for the DL 44C California Commercial Driver License Application form. It is mandatory that the original DL 44C is submitted, the copies are not accepted by DMV. The DL 44 or DL44C form is not provided online by the department because original signatures are required on the form. Every DL 44C or DL 44 form holds a unique barcode that is scanned by the DMV employee. Get a DL 44 or DL 44 C form through DMV's Automated Telephone Service at 1-800-777-0133(which is available 24 hours a day, 7 days per week).
